Obituary of Thomas Pisel
Thomas W. Pisel, 94, died Monday, September 24, 2007 at Martin Memorial Medical Center in Stuart.
Born in Bloomdale, Ohio, he has resided in Martin County for 35 years moving to Stuart from Westlake, OH in 1972 and later to Palm City.
He retired as Manager of Organization and Development after 30 years with General Motors Corporation. After retirement he was vice president of Sales Analysis Institute in Oak Park, IL.
He was an Army Air Corps veteran of World War II serving in Technical Service Command, Troop Carrier Command and Director of Manpower-Air Service Command.
He was a member of Palm City Presbyterian Church and served on the Membership Planning, Pastor Search and Stewardship Committees.
He was a former board member of Florida Mental Health Association and founding member of Crisis Line of Martin County.
He was an avid bridge player and reader.
He was preceded in death by his wife, Tyris Pisel and brother, Malcolm Pisel. He was survived by a nephew, Charles N. Hruska, and two grandnieces, Ellie DeLeon and Nickola Vail.
